Stevedore -- DocWorker for the heavy lifting

View

A Viewer looks at documents with a web browser such as Firefox [Screen Shots - View Document]. The documents are just web pages. There are some documents that have special presentation requirements. These are stored as PDF files but are also viewed with the web browser.

Edit

When an Editor wishes to make a change to a document, they simply Check Out the document by clicking on the CheckOutButton at the bottom of the Firefox border [Screen Shots - CheckOut/Edit/CheckIn Document]. The editable variant of the document is placed in their personal MyStevedoreFolder. This file is normally the OpenOffice variant of the document whose file type is .odt, but html files with type .htm are also supported. This does not require the Editor to know where the editable variant of the document lives. Simply viewing it in Firefox is sufficient to locate it. Finally, an email will be sent to those of concern, indicating who is now working on this document.

Publish

The Editor makes changes to the document using OpenOffice. To Check the file back in, the Editor simply drags the file from the MyStevedoreFolder to the CheckInToPublishFolder [Screen Shots - CheckOut/Edit/CheckIn Document]. Automagically, the new version of the document will be placed back into the system. In addition, the OpenOffice variant of the document will be converted into both a web page and a PDF formatted file, which will be published for everyone to view. Finally, an email will be sent to those of concern announcing the new version.

Summary

Viewers and Editors may easily point others to documents, via email for example, by simply sending the URL. This is easily done in Firefox by using File>SendLink [Screen Shots - "Send" Document]. This will ensure that all Viewers and Editors see the most recent version. There will be no more need to keep piles of old emails with attachments because you cannot access a document kept in Samba share silos.

Since you will be able to view the current version of a document with your web browser, you can delete those old emails. Obsolete versions of documents are available if needed. They are safe in the document library. All who need to see them or change them will have easy access. You will no longer keep personal copies of documents you worked on in the past in your personal folders. You will no longer keep copies of documents from other departments, because they are just a link away. For frequently used documents, you can use the Favorites or Bookmarks feature of your web browser. You can also use desktop icons to link to documents or even for your personal MyStevedoreFolder and CheckInToPublishFolder.
